Slurry Walls / Diaphragm Walls


 

A slurry wall (diaphragm wall) is a cast insitu, underground wall excavated from the surface with the aid of stabilizing fluids (generally polymers or bentonite mud), constructed with contiguous elements.

No structural/permanent slurry walls/diaphragm walls have been constructed yet in British Columba. However in order for Matcon to be prepared to fulfill the future needs of our beautiful province, we are actively developing this shoring/foundation technology jointly with our geotechnical consultants.
